[Asia Economy Reporter Kiho Sung] T’Station, a tire-centered total automotive service specialist store operated by Hankook Tire & Technology (hereinafter Hankook Tire), announced on the 18th that it will run the ‘2021 Cheer Up Korea’ promotion, conveying support for the New Year, until the 28th of next month.
This event was prepared to deliver a strong message of encouragement to the people of Korea who have been exhausted by the prolonged COVID-19 pandemic, and it will be held at T’Station offline stores nationwide as well as on the integrated online and offline service platform Tstation.com. Customers who choose one of the 10 promotional products, including Hankook Tire’s flagship product lineup Ventus, Kinergy, and Dynapro, and purchase four or more tires will be eligible for benefits.
First, customers who purchase four or more tires eligible for the promotion using affiliated cards such as KB Kookmin Card, Samsung Card, or Citi Card will receive a 40,000 KRW mobile fuel voucher. Additionally, the contactless tire replacement service called ‘Smart Pickup Service’ and the ‘Smart Assurance Service,’ which compensates with new tires, will be provided free of charge.
The Smart Pickup Service is a service where a professional driver visits the customer at the desired time and specified location to pick up the car, perform tire replacement, and return the car. The Smart Assurance Service offers free replacement of tires damaged within one year or 16,000 km of driving after purchase and installation at T’Station with new tires of the same product.
